Output 8aa887643b03d1ab35a894a0cbd6f2e39313afbd15c59a66a49c4f98a93d052c:2

value
22164566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57d0bb7f2108befd9cc47c15e25b7a22dbda787d OP_EQUAL
address
39hLmDRXMcwwHzo4s6WNNYDYDLzG9StvRs
transaction
8aa887643b03d1ab35a894a0cbd6f2e39313afbd15c59a66a49c4f98a93d052c
spent
true